A collateralized debt obligation (CDO) is a complex financial product backed by a pool of loans and other assets and sold to institutional investors.

A collateralized debt obligation cubed (CDO-cubed) is a derivative security backed by a collateralized debt obligation squared (CDO-squared) tranche.

A synthetic CDO is a collateralized debt obligation that invests in credit default swaps or other non-cash assets to gain exposure to fixed income.
